Working Principles

The KA3882CDTF operates as a linear voltage regulator. It compares the output voltage with a reference voltage and adjusts the internal circuitry to maintain a stable output voltage. The adjustable pin allows users to set the desired output voltage within the specified range. The overcurrent protection feature monitors the output current and limits it to a safe level. In case of excessive temperature, the thermal shutdown protection activates, temporarily disabling the IC until the temperature returns to a safe range.
